Output e6a606953b8c6edaba99971489ac6a8711f9a39ca1bef5fe36cbf012ef3543f0:0

value
115540829
script pubkey
OP_0 OP_PUSHBYTES_20 18eca761a77ecafb904a8e2e659782d0df4ff5ea
address
bc1qrrk2wcd80m90hyz23chxt9uz6r05la020h3849
transaction
e6a606953b8c6edaba99971489ac6a8711f9a39ca1bef5fe36cbf012ef3543f0
spent
true